产品经理要懂什么编程

worktile 其他 53

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    作为产品经理,虽然不要求掌握深入的编程技术,但了解一些编程知识对于工作的顺利进行是非常有帮助的。下面是产品经理应该掌握的一些基本编程概念和技能:

    1. 基本编程概念:产品经理应该了解编程的基本概念和术语,比如变量、函数、循环、条件语句等。这将帮助他们更好地与开发团队进行沟通,理解他们所看到的代码。

    2. 前端技术:产品经理应该了解一些基本的前端技术,如HTML、CSS和JavaScript。这些技术是构建Web应用程序的基础,产品经理能够理解前端开发的工作流程,能够更好地与前端开发人员合作。

    3. 数据库基础:了解数据库的基本概念和SQL语言是必要的。产品经理需要理解数据的存储和检索方式,以便更好地设计产品的数据结构和功能。

    4. 接口设计:产品经理需要熟悉一些常用的接口概念,如API和RESTful接口。这将帮助他们与后端开发人员进行有效的沟通,确保产品的功能能够与后端系统进行无缝集成。

    5. 敏捷开发方法:产品经理应该了解敏捷开发方法,并熟悉一些敏捷开发工具和流程,如Scrum和Kanban。这将有助于他们更好地与开发团队协作,提高产品的迭代速度和质量。

    总而言之,虽然产品经理不需要成为开发专家,但了解一些基本的编程概念和技能对于他们的工作是非常有益的。这将帮助他们更好地与开发团队合作,理解技术实现的可行性,提高产品的质量和用户体验。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    作为产品经理,懂一些编程知识是非常有益的。尽管产品经理的主要职责是负责产品的策划、设计和管理,但对编程有一定了解可以帮助产品经理更好地与开发团队沟通,理解技术的可行性,并更好地推动产品的开发和上线。以下是产品经理应该了解的一些编程知识:

    1. 基础编程概念:产品经理应该了解一些基本的编程概念,例如变量、条件语句、循环语句、函数等。这些概念有助于理解开发团队的代码实现。

    2. 前端开发知识:产品经理应该了解前端开发的基本知识,例如HTML、CSS和JavaScript。这有助于他们更好地理解前端开发的工作流程和技术。

    3. 后端开发知识:产品经理应该了解后端开发的基本知识,例如数据库、API设计和服务器端编程语言(如Python、Java等)。这有助于他们理解后端开发的技术实现和数据管理的流程。

    4. 数据库知识:产品经理应该了解一些数据库的基本知识,例如关系型数据库和非关系型数据库的差异、SQL查询的语法等。这有助于他们更好地理解数据的存储和管理。

    5. 接口文档阅读:产品经理需要能够阅读和理解接口文档,了解接口的参数、返回值和使用方式。这有助于他们与开发团队进行有效的沟通,并确保产品的功能需求得到正确实现。

    尽管产品经理不需要成为编程专家,但对编程有一定的了解可以增强其与开发团队的协作能力,提高产品的质量和交付效率。而且,随着技术的快速发展和互联网行业的竞争激烈,产品经理若具备一定的编程知识,在职场中也会更具竞争力。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    作为产品经理,虽然不需要具备专业的编程技能,但对于一些基本的编程概念和流程有一定的了解是非常有帮助的。这样可以让产品经理与开发团队更好地沟通协作,理解技术难题和制定合理的产品需求。

    以下是一些产品经理应该了解的编程知识和概念:

    1. 基本的编程概念:了解基本的编程语言、变量、函数、条件语句、循环等基本概念,可以帮助产品经理更好地理解和讨论开发问题。

    2. 前端技术:了解HTML、CSS和JavaScript等前端技术,可以帮助产品经理了解用户界面的设计和开发流程,以及前端开发人员面临的技术挑战。

    3. 数据库和后端技术:了解数据库的基本概念和SQL查询语言,可以帮助产品经理更好地理解数据存储和处理的方式。此外,了解后端技术的基本概念也能够帮助产品经理更好地理解系统架构和后端开发的过程。

    4. API和Web服务:了解API(应用程序接口)以及Web服务的基本概念,可以帮助产品经理与开发团队协商和确认不同系统之间的数据交互方式。

    5. 敏捷开发和软件生命周期:了解敏捷开发和软件生命周期的基本概念,可以帮助产品经理与开发团队更好地协作和理解产品开发的整个过程。

    6. 调试和测试:了解一些基本的调试和测试技术,可以帮助产品经理更好地帮助开发团队发现和解决问题。

    尽管产品经理不需要成为编程专家,但通过了解这些基本概念和流程,产品经理可以更好地与开发团队合作,理解技术难题和制定合理的需求,进而提高产品开发的效率和质量。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部